Mercurial > emacs
changeset 53655:4f64423a6040
(buffer_defaults, buffer_local_symbols): Use DECL_ALIGN.
author | Stefan Monnier <monnier@iro.umontreal.ca> |
---|---|
date | Wed, 21 Jan 2004 04:32:19 +0000 |
parents | 8dc805af6250 |
children | f2b9a3d38bf2 |
files | src/buffer.c |
diffstat | 1 files changed, 4 insertions(+), 3 deletions(-) [+] |
line wrap: on
line diff
--- a/src/buffer.c Wed Jan 21 04:31:21 2004 +0000 +++ b/src/buffer.c Wed Jan 21 04:32:19 2004 +0000 @@ -1,5 +1,5 @@ /* Buffer manipulation primitives for GNU Emacs. - Copyright (C) 1985,86,87,88,89,93,94,95,97,98, 1999, 2000, 2001, 02, 2003 + Copyright (C) 1985,86,87,88,89,93,94,95,97,98, 1999, 2000, 2001, 02, 03, 2004 Free Software Foundation, Inc. This file is part of GNU Emacs. @@ -67,7 +67,7 @@ Setting the default value also goes through the alist of buffers and stores into each buffer that does not say it has a local value. */ -struct buffer buffer_defaults; +DECL_ALIGN (struct buffer, buffer_defaults); /* A Lisp_Object pointer to the above, used for staticpro */ @@ -97,7 +97,8 @@ /* This structure holds the names of symbols whose values may be buffer-local. It is indexed and accessed in the same way as the above. */ -struct buffer buffer_local_symbols; +DECL_ALIGN (struct buffer, buffer_local_symbols); + /* A Lisp_Object pointer to the above, used for staticpro */ static Lisp_Object Vbuffer_local_symbols;